Output ab6e223a7639f6671218964a9ed5c2e3d6e6e2cb326e38bdc115bfc029a52422:2

value
24946393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34bc2691c6954e897685a6245fcd49f419e7630a OP_EQUAL
address
MChzmLpZJeVS4kKGth8LTnF6NSEhKzVUUJ
transaction
ab6e223a7639f6671218964a9ed5c2e3d6e6e2cb326e38bdc115bfc029a52422
spent
true